  • Abstract
    This paper presents the RTExpressTM environment which is a software tool that assists a user in rapidly developing real-time embedded systems. RTExpress(TM) is a compiler and runtime environment that provides the capability for MATLABR script files to be directly compiled and then executed on parallel high performance computers (HPC). RTExpressTM provides the capability to employ the power of an HPC on standard MATLABR without having to recode the MATLABR in the HPC target language. Its features include support for real-time data and machine performance visualization, multiple parallelization paradigms, multiple homogeneous parallel architectures, utilization of machine specific optimized vector libraries and native compilers, and the ability to change real-time algorithm parameters on-the-fly
